  When we select " Process Bid invitation" in EBP, we have find button through which we can filter the Bid invitations and open the same. But it lists even the Bid invitations which i am not authorised.
For ex.
Bid invitations created by "P1" purchasing group are Bid1, Bid2 & Bid3.
Bid invitations cerated by "P2" purchasing group are Bid 11, Bid12 & Bid13.
P1 purchaser can open the Bid invitations (Bid11,Bid12 & Bid13)created by P2 and can publish. Is there any control in org.structure or it is only through authorisation objects.
There is a selection criteria "My Bid invitations". But it can be used to open only my bid invitations not restricting others to open my bids.

go to PFCG
Create a new role for Example ZBR01_EC_BBP_OP_RM1
BR01 is a plant
RM1 is a pruchase group
and go to authorisation and display authorisation data . then go to organisational levels  and maintain purchase group , purchase organisation.

  • Notification when Bid Invitation is Published

    Hi,
    We are using SRM 5.0 classic scenario.
    We have a requirement to send an email to some specific users, when a bid invitation is published. I suppose, the email is triggered to vendors by default.
    The specific users are determined from bid invitation document.
    Is there any way to configure this via. Alert Management? I checked in Event Schemas but there is nothing for 'Bid Invitation Published'. Can we add this as an entry there?
    What are the steps to activate this alert?
    Anybody worked on Alert Management, please share the steps.
    Any alternative ideas other than using Alert management are also welcome. (like we thought of writing code to send mail in DOC_SAVE badi, but we needed to verify whether Bid got published, as this badi is called before saving document).

    Hi,
    In define event  schema for the business object 'BUS2200' there will on schema 'RFQ' defined in the standard. For the schema RFQ there is an event called PUBLISHED already available in the standard. Here if you do not make any entry tthe alerts will go as soon as bid is published. If you put a value say 1, alert will trigger after 1 hour from the bid publication.

  • Publish Bid Invitations.

    Hi Guys, need help in the following:
    1) What does public bid Inviation mean? My understanding is that we will not have to assign any bidders to the bid invitation and it get published on a portal.
    2) How do I publish the bid on a portal - I want to publish the bid invitation on Internet where the suppliers can see the opportunity for businees?
    3) How does it work - Do we have to generate a PDF using smart form and then put it on the net some how?
    4) How will the vendors respond to the Open Bid Invitation as they are not created in the system and do not have login details?
    Kind Regards,
    Abdul Kadir Rajbhoy

    Hi,
    Yes you are right.Public Bid Invitation means that any body can bid to the event.If Bidders are involved then it becomes Restricted Bid Invitation.
    In Public Bid Invitation,you need to give  link to which the intending bidder need to get registered by answering a questionnaire published by your enterprise.Once his registration is approved by the enterprise, he will be issued a userid & Pwd and he will be in a position to submit Bid response.
    This requires the setting up of the Supplier Registration scenario.

  • Publish date of a bid invitation

    Hi,
    There is a function or table that can give the date on I published a bid invitation?
    Thank you,
    joseph fryda

    Hi,
    Table:
    BBP_PDHSB field quot_dead - for quot deadline
    BBP_PDHSB field start_time - for time stamp for start time
    CRMD_ORDERADM_H field created_at - for created on date
    or FM:
    BBP_LA_BID_GETDETAIL
    BBP_PD_BID_GETDETAIL

  • Url for public tender/bid invitation?

    Dear Gurus,
    We are configuring public tender/ bid invitation document in our SRM server 7.01 (SRM 7 enhancement pack 1).
    We have created a bid invitation document of type public. It has gone through approval and got published. We have not configured the system for decoupled bidding (bidding response from SUS available from SRM 7.01).
    In which portal, the bid invitation will be published? is it the supplier portal or there will be separate portal link available for the same? Could you please give me a hint where to look for the public tender?
    Secondly, who will get to see the public tender? Are only the suppliers present in the SRM system or any supplier who is even not registered with the client can see the public tender?
    Any inputs will be highly appreciated.
    Thanks and regards,
    Ranjan
    Ranjan Sutradhar

    Dear Ranjan,
    Your requirement can be achieved with the press tendering(paper add or advertisement on company website), where the client will be giving the details related to the Bid invitation so that the suppliers can view them and if interested they can register themselves to access the bid invitation and proceed with the follow on activities for response submission.
    As you have mentioned , you can publish a link in the client main page referring to the Bid invitation with details and asking the interested suppliers to registered themselves via supplier registration url , so that a corresponding business partner will be generated for them in the SRM system and at the same time purchaser will be notified with the interested suppliers.
    Once the supplier is registered, then they can access the bid invitation with there login credentials.
    But at no point of time suppliers without registering in the SRM system can access the Bid invitation.

  • Custom field in Create Bid Invitation..

    Hi,
       I have to add a custome field in the 'Create Bid Invitation - Find bid invitation - Extended Search screen. has anyone done this same scenario.
    john.

    hi,
    I dont think you can add custom field at the item overview level.
    There is nothing in standard for CUF in item overview.
    CUF are available in Header/item basic data, accounting and search screens, but nothing in item overview.
    The only workaround which i can see is to modify the HTML page in the Internet Service .
    You can try to use some standard field which stores the information you want to display (instead oc creating a custom field).e.g.If you want to display the Product CAtegory in addition to its description on the item overview screen(Table control),then you will have to find out the std field which stores the Prod category value.
    If the standard populates that field  with the info you require you'll not have to populate it yourself: so check it.
    Be careful to add this column as the last column in the Table control, as the template refers to column numbers for existing data.
    Then change the template  in order to manage the field display in the different cases (selection and display).
    DO NOT COPY STANDARD PROGRAM, or you will loose modification tracking during upgrade or SP applications.
    Be careful. The same HTML templates of the Internet Service are (shared) used for all the users. So be very sure in making changes to the standard HTML template and publishing those changes. Incase of shortdumps here, you need to go through each line in the Service to see the cause of the error(which might be as silly as missing a comma, bracket, period after a line). SAP dump analysis is not much help here.
